Abstract

This paper establishes an evaluation index system of coordinated relationship between urban rail transit and land use. And the data envelopment analysis (DEA) model is applied to evaluate the coordinated relationship between urban rail transit and land use of Beijing from 2001 to 2014. Evaluation results that are generated by the model are conducive to analyze the change rule of coordination and find out the main factors which restrict coordinated development. The results show that, on the whole, Beijing rail transit and land-use fail to realize coordinated development. The contributing value of ratio of employees to citizens is maximum in the input values of land use system and the proportion of transit trips ranks first in the input values of urban rail transit system, which indicates the unbalanced space distribution of employment and residence and the low proportion of green transportation are key factors that have restricted the coordinated development between urban rail transit and land use. Additional, the improved values of invalid decision making units (DMU) are calculated in the paper with the guide of projection theory so as to provide a reference for the development of urban rail transit and land use.
